Ms.De'Aira

Owner/Instructor

I'm De'Aira, a native of Georgia, and I've dedicated over 15 years of my life to the art of dance. From a young age, I found joy in sharing my passion with my community, and at just 15 years old, I took the leap and started my very first dance camp. Over the years, that camp grew and expanded, providing me with the incredible opportunity to collaborate with the YMCA and various summer programs. However, my ultimate dream was always to establish a dance studio where I could teach and inspire young minds through dance on a full-time basis. 

My journey led me to the University of Georgia, where I pursued my formal education in dance, honing my skills and developing deeper into the art form. Along the way, I had the privilege of training under renowned figures such as Alvin Ailey 2, Travis Wall, and members of the Garth Fagan Company, an experience that enriched my understanding and appreciation of dance. 

Beyond my personal growth as a dancer, I've also had the exciting opportunity to showcase my talent on television series like "American Soul" and "Boomerang." While these moments were undoubtedly thrilling, my heart has always been drawn to teaching and nurturing young dancers. 

For me, teaching dance and making a positive impact on the lives of youth has been my true calling from the very beginning. Witnessing the growth and transformation of my students as they explore the world of dance brings me immense joy and fulfillment. It's a privilege to be a part of their journey and to help them discover their own artistic potential and witness the character development along the way. 

More recently, I've expanded my horizons and embarked on the path of Behavioral Therapy and Preschool Teaching. These additional experiences have allowed me to develop a deeper understanding of child development and strengthen my ability to create a nurturing and supportive environment for young learners. 

I am determined to provide a space where creativity flourishes, and the youth can find their voices through the beauty of movement. My commitment to inspiring and empowering the next generation of dancers remains steadfast, and I look forward to creating a lasting impact on their lives.
